Form Factor and Compatibility

The memory module is configured as a 288-pin RDIMM (Registered DIMM), which offers added stability for server platforms by buffering the address and command lines. Its registered nature makes it ideal for dual-processor and multi-processor systems, avoiding signal degradation in high-density configurations. Dell’s 370-BCJG is tested and certified for a range of PowerEdge servers and is backward compatible with platforms supporting DDR5 RDIMM memory.

ECC (Error-Correcting Code) Technology

Integrated ECC technology helps automatically detect and correct common types of memory errors, which enhances data integrity and minimizes system crashes. For data center administrators and IT professionals managing large-scale operations, ECC provides peace of mind by reducing system downtime and ensuring critical workloads are not interrupted by memory-related faults.

Voltage and Latency Optimization

Operating at a low voltage of 1.1v, this DDR5 memory module significantly reduces power consumption compared to previous generations. Lower voltage operation not only reduces energy costs in large server environments but also contributes to decreased heat output, aiding in thermal management. The memory has a CAS latency (CL) of 46, which ensures balanced responsiveness and efficiency for read/write operations.

Understanding DDR5 and PC5-44800 Memory Architecture

DDR5 Evolution from DDR4

DDR5 SDRAM represents a substantial advancement over DDR4. With increased memory bandwidth, improved power efficiency, and architectural enhancements, DDR5 allows for superior scalability in computing systems. Dell’s 370-BCJG module leverages these benefits, offering faster data rates, higher capacity per DIMM, and improved reliability.

Bandwidth Advantages

The 5600MT/s transfer rate enables greater data throughput, making this module ideal for applications such as AI/ML modeling, in-memory databases, virtualization platforms, and real-time data processing. PC5-44800 classification denotes a peak bandwidth of 44.8 GB/s per DIMM, a leap from the maximum bandwidth of PC4-32000 in DDR4.

Channel Architecture Enhancements

DDR5 introduces a dual 32-bit channel per DIMM (versus a single 64-bit channel in DDR4), improving parallelism and reducing latency. The Dell 370-BCJG module supports this architecture, offering higher overall system efficiency and more granular memory access.

On-Die ECC and Power Management

Unlike DDR4, DDR5 includes on-die ECC for internal error correction and a Power Management IC (PMIC) on the DIMM itself. These features increase the module’s self-reliance and enable finer voltage regulation, which further enhances performance stability and thermal control in high-load environments.

FAQs About Dell 370-BCJG DDR5 64GB ECC Memory

No. DDR5 and DDR4 modules are physically and electrically incompatible. The 370-BCJG memory module is designed solely for DDR5 platforms and cannot be used alongside DDR4 DIMMs.

Memory suitable for gaming desktops

This is a server-grade RDIMM module, not designed for consumer-grade desktops or gaming PCs, which typically use unbuffered DIMMs (UDIMMs). Ensure your system supports registered ECC DDR5 memory before purchase.
